Geraldine Dorothea Trebesh, age 99, of Greenville, passed away Wednesday, April 4, 2012 at her home. The daughter of John A. & Edna H. (Michael) Miles, she was born on September 3, 1912 in Detroit.
On October 9, 1946, in Tucson, Arizona, she married Earl R. Trebesh and together they raised two children and enjoyed 55 years of marriage. Following retirement, they moved from St. Clair Shores to Largo, Florida, returning to Michigan in 2001. Earl preceded her in death on August 14, 2002.
For the past few years Geraldine made her home at Green Acres in Greenville where she delighted in being active in the many social activities, including organizing the Kitchen Band at Green Acres.
Surviving are a daughter, Donna Trebesh of Greenville; a son, Dennis (Jeannie) Trebesh of Rochester Hills; three grandsons, Kevin (Andrea)Trebesh, Craig Trebesh, and Matthew Trebesh; a sister-in-law, Beatrice Thomann of Taylor; and several nieces and nephews.
